WebJun 6, 2024 · Mark The Degree. Equally important is the degrees of the fish sauce. “The degrees (°N) on the label of Vietnamese fish sauce represent the protein content. The higher the value, the higher the protein content and the umami, and the higher the price,” Chan explains. The degrees of Vietnamese fish sauce varies from 20°N to 60°N. how to save email to pdf

Bagoóng ( Tagalog pronunciation: [bɐɡuˈoŋ]; buh-goo-ONG) is a Philippine condiment partially or completely made of either fermented fish ( bagoóng) or krill or shrimp paste ( alamáng) with salt.
